Output edf2c71c6faf0745c45de12e864ff052c1a8a73d10d92ac2c7a9e91c1d4c2c53:58

value
1537710698
script pubkey
OP_0 OP_PUSHBYTES_32 a8f141c2319f2b1eb0e01ba179f21959ee031d118369cfc90630cdabfdcb19b7
address
bc1q4rc5rs33nu43av8qrwshnuset8hqx8g3sd5uljgxxrx6hlwtrxmsmkznnp
transaction
edf2c71c6faf0745c45de12e864ff052c1a8a73d10d92ac2c7a9e91c1d4c2c53
confirmations
179442
spent
true